Tribute Poem from Seth Belsey - Ace’s Brother in Law

Ace Rizzle Rock

 

What Up Y’all!

 Ace is in the place.

We feel him …… and wish we could squeeze him one more time

He’s with us in Word…..and he always had the perfect thing to say

It’s been heartening to hear all the perfect words said for him today

 

I’ve wondered so many things since he left..

Is this a plan

Was this his plan

Divine man with a divine plan

Or Clandestine Destiny

 Do you know the god Woden’s son died by being pierced with Mistletoe

Ace found a sweetness in longing and yearning, and said peace with a kiss

 When I was in Rolf school, I was asked once what I thought was up with Ace.  I said, I believe his skin is on too tight.  But that was a symptom not a cause.  Now I know that his Soul was simply too big for his body.

 

There was a hunger for Love and Rhythmic Beauty in the depths of his Spirit.

And is there anything more satisfying than:

Soul Nourishment

It’s Soul Significant

Soul Unusual

Soul Mysterious

Soul Incredible

 The Soul celebrates, for what is not born, never dies

 I love that photo of young Ace in cowboy boots on his tricycle

Big Boy

Big Wheels

Superman Cape

Big Feels

 

I picture Ace following his own line drawn direction into existence

Yes, over time the edges yellowed and crinkles did appear

But the eraser still remarked, there’s nothing to undo here.

 

We’ve been looking through his portfolio, and he kept some drawings from when he was a kid. 

I like the thought that he knew that he had created a treasure from his chest.

 Ace the Artist created from passion and pressure.  Late nights and sacrifice. 

He often did it the Hard Way, but he never wanted us to feel or take it the hard way.

Raspy Rascal

Ritalin me this

Sight for Monte Sore Eyes

Bouncing muse, Cherished and Bruised

Biochemically focused, mental hocus pocus

Future Self took a Toke

3rd eye winked at the joke

Now I want to know, does an Angel have to step out for a smoke?!

 

Ace of all suits played the hand he was dealt

He was a Real One

Touch of Class in saggy pants

Misty flipping misanthrope

Shell toed minstrel

Alliterative Allegorical Alex

 

Ever seen, Ever dream, Ever lean, Ever team, Never mean with Clever esteem,

that’s our Mr. Evergreen

 We offer you our tears to purify the wounds, and more tears towards life’s secrets and hidden things.  Our tears unite us in this moment and float our broken hearts to you in Heaven.

We offer you our smiles and Thank you for all the True caring Love moments

Smiles for every self portrait hung upside down

Smiles for a Lion with a crown.

Smiles knowing we will be together again.

Smiles for Family, Friendship and Oneness, Amen.

 

~Seth Belsey
